Major Titles
|
5 WSOP bracelets, including one for winning the 1986 Main Event. |
None, although he did take second at the 2007 WPT Mandalay Bay Poker Championship. |
Johnston is an old school trooper who’s been playing since they days of poker legends such as Johnny Moss and Amarillo Slim, plus he’s a cashing machine in the Main Event, having done so a record 10 times. So Hamby’s going to have a hell of a time catching up to him. But give the boy a few years and see where he’s at. Until then, this category belongs to Berry – he leads 2-0. |
